Capturing the Essence of an Under-the-Sea Gown

An Ariel-inspired wedding dress often features a mermaid or trumpet silhouette that gracefully hugs the body before flaring out at the bottom, mimicking a mermaid's tail. Details might include iridescent sequins that shimmer like scales, delicate lace resembling coral, or soft tulle that flows like ocean waves. Bringing this vision to life, whether through a designer gown or a custom creation, is a key part of making your fairytale wedding a reality. The key is to focus on elements that evoke the spirit of the sea and the romance of the story.

Budgeting for Your Dream Dress

While dreaming is free, custom and designer wedding dresses come with a significant price tag. It's essential to create a detailed wedding budget early in the planning process. According to wedding planning experts at The Knot, the cost of a wedding dress can vary widely. Setting a realistic budget helps you narrow down your options and avoid financial strain. Remember to account for alterations, accessories like a veil and shoes, and preservation costs after the wedding. Careful planning ensures your dress remains a source of joy, not stress.
